Spanning over a duration of 24 months, the program delves into critical subjects such as cellular structure, function, and the intricate processes that underpin cellular behavior. Students will explore a wide range of courses, including Advanced Cell Biology, Molecular Genetics, and Experimental Techniques in Cell Biology. Each course is structured to promote critical thinking and foster a deep appreciation for the complexities of cellular life. Additionally, students will have the opportunity to participate in hands-on laboratory work, utilizing state-of-the-art technology to enhance their learning experience and cultivate their research capabilities.

For prospective students, the admission criteria for the Master of Science in Cell Biology program include a bachelor’s degree in a relevant field, along with a strong academic record. Additionally, applicants must demonstrate proficiency in English through standardized testing such as IELTS (minimum score of 6.5) or TOEFL (minimum score of 81). The application process also requires a completed application form, a personal statement, and letters of recommendation. A non-refundable application fee of $100 is necessary to process applications.

Graduates with a Master's in Cell Biology from NYMC have entered industry or continued their professional education by pursuing further research (Ph.D.) or clinical practice (medical school). Within a research setting, a master's degree can lead to professional advancement. Career settings can include agriculture, the pharmaceutical industry, or biotechnology firms. Potential roles include biomedical engineer, forensic scientist, or food scientist. The university provides career planning services, including a Career Planning Curriculum, to help students explore career options and prepare for their professional lives.
